Since when has MECHANICS OF ADVANCED MATERIALS AND STRUCTURES been publishing? Faqs

The MECHANICS OF ADVANCED MATERIALS AND STRUCTURES has been publishing since 2002 till date.

How frequently is the MECHANICS OF ADVANCED MATERIALS AND STRUCTURES published? Faqs

MECHANICS OF ADVANCED MATERIALS AND STRUCTURES is published Semi-monthly.

Who is the publisher of MECHANICS OF ADVANCED MATERIALS AND STRUCTURES? Faqs

The publisher of MECHANICS OF ADVANCED MATERIALS AND STRUCTURES is TAYLOR & FRANCIS INC.

Why is it important to find the right journal for my research? Faqs

Choosing the right journal ensures that your research reaches the most relevant audience, thereby maximizing its scholarly impact and contribution to the field.

Can the choice of journal affect my academic career? Faqs

Absolutely. Publishing in reputable journals can enhance your academic profile, making you more competitive for grants, tenure, and other professional opportunities.

Is it advisable to target high-impact journals only? Faqs

While high-impact journals offer greater visibility, they are often highly competitive. It's essential to balance the journal's impact factor with the likelihood of your work being accepted.
